| char *GeneratePairingCode(uint32_t pairingCodeLen) |
| { |
| char *pairingCode; |
| |
| pairingCode = (char *)malloc(pairingCodeLen + 1); |
| if (pairingCode == NULL) |
| { |
| fprintf(stderr, "Memory allocation error\n"); |
| ExitNow(pairingCode = NULL); |
| } |
| |
| // Generate random data for the pairing code, excluding the check digit at the end. |
| if (!RAND_bytes((uint8_t *)pairingCode, pairingCodeLen - 1)) |
| ReportOpenSSLErrorAndExit("Failed to get random data", pairingCode = NULL); |
| |
| // Convert the random data to characters in the range 0-9, A-H, J-N, P, R-Y (base-32 alphanumeric, excluding I, O, Q and Z). |
| for (uint32_t i = 0; i < pairingCodeLen - 1; i++) |
| { |
| uint8_t val = (uint8_t)pairingCode[i] / 8; |
| pairingCode[i] = Verhoeff32::ValToChar(val); |
| } |
| |
| // Compute the check digit. |
| pairingCode[pairingCodeLen - 1] = Verhoeff32::ComputeCheckChar(pairingCode, pairingCodeLen - 1); |
| |
| // Terminate the string. |
| pairingCode[pairingCodeLen] = 0; |
| |
| exit: |
| return pairingCode; |
| } |
